This recipe was extracted from Mrs. Roundell's Practical cookery book (1898) by Roundell, Charles Mrs, page 252. The excerpt below is the record exactly as published.
Baked Tomatoes. — Butter a baking-tin "well, and sprinkle it with a very little stock, using as little liquid as possible. Set the Tomatoes on the tin and cover them closely with a buttered paper
